Extract PDF Content
PDF Content Extraction
Extract text, images, tables, and more from native and scanned PDFs into a structured JSON file. PDF Extract API leverages AI technology to accurately identify text objects and understand the natural reading order of different elements such as headings, lists, and paragraphs spanning multiple columns or pages. Extract font styles with identification of metadata such as bold and italic text and their position within your PDF. Extracted content is output in a structured JSON file format with tables in CSV or XLSX and images saved as PNG.

Secure PDF
Secure a PDF file and set restrictions
Secure a PDF file with a password encrypt the document. Set an owner password and restrictions on certain features like printing, editing and copying in the PDF document to prevent end users from modifying it.
Support for AES-128 and AES-256 encryption on PDF files, with granular permissions for high and low quality printing and fill and sign form field restrictions.See our public API Reference and quickly try our APIs using the Postman collections

Get PDF Properties
Get the properties of a PDF file
Use this service to get the metadata properties of a PDF. Metadata including page count, PDF version, file size, compliance levels, font info, permissions and more are provided in JSON format for easy processing.
This data can be used to: check if a document is fully text searchable (OCR), understand the e-signature certificate info, find out compliance levels (e.g., PDF/A and PDF/UA), assess file size before compressing, check permissions related to copy, edit, printing, encryption, and much more.

Linearize PDF
Linearize a PDF File for Fast Web View
Optimize PDFs for quick viewing on the web, especially for mobile clients. Linearization allows your end users to view large PDF documents incrementally so that they can view pages much faster in lower bandwidth conditions.
